This substantial and beautifully presented detached family home is tucked away in a quiet cul-de-sac within the ever-popular Boyatt Wood area, offering generous and versatile accommodation ideal for modern family living.
The property is arranged over two floors and is particularly well suited to multi-generational living, with a ground floor double bedroom benefiting from its own en-suite shower room. The remainder of the ground floor is centred around spacious and well-proportioned living areas, including a bright sitting room, a contemporary kitchen both complemented by additional reception space ideal for dining or family use.
Located off the kitchen is a well-proportioned utility room, providing excellent additional storage and workspace, with direct access opening onto a separate area of the rear garden.
To the first floor are four further bedrooms, all of good size. The impressive principal bedroom enjoys its own en-suite bathroom along with a dedicated dressing area, while the remaining bedrooms are served by a well-appointed family bathroom.
Externally, the property sits on a generous plot with an extensive rear garden. The garden is a real highlight, offering a high degree of privacy and featuring mature trees subject to preservation orders, creating a peaceful and established setting. There are multiple storage areas, as well as a superb outdoor entertaining space complete with a covered seating area and fire pit, perfect for year-round enjoyment.
